B. Museum—

I fear I must look at Poly. Hardwickii & Malaccense [Polyplectron] - Are they synonymous? I say the P. Hard has top-knot & ocelli in true tail-feathers approximate & confluent in tail-coverts. In P. Malaccense, the ocelli tend to disappear in true tail-feathers & are confluent in tail-coverts

[in margin:] When I see drawings I can judge
